I've got just the opposite problem. I was banded 6 days ago and am on the soft diet (soups in a blender, Jello, pudding, Protein Shakes, etc) now and can barely eat 1/3 of a cup without feeling like I just finished Thanksgiving dinner. I am averaging 400 calories a day and the doctor said to try to get in 60 - 70 grams of protien a day - I can barely do 30. I have my first post op meeting with the doctor tomorrow and will have many questions, I was told I would have my first fill in about 2 weeks, but unless something changes drastically, don;t see that I will need one. I am retaining a lot of Water however, my legs and ankles are very swollen and according to the scale have gained 3 pounds since surgery - reading other threads I see this is somewhat normal though.

Whats Up with the Shoulder Pain??
in POST-Operation Weight Loss Surgery Q&A
Posted
As was already said, its from the gas they use to 'inflate you' to make it easier to view and work inside you.
Mine lasted about 2 days and was not too terrible, but was told to walk and walk and walk some more to get rid of it. That worked, the more I walked the better I felt.
